Most website redesigns take between 6 and 16 weeks depending on the size of the site, complexity of the design, number of integrations and whether content migration or platform changes are involved. A focused B2B or SaaS website redesign is typically faster than a large ecommerce or enterprise redesign. We provide a detailed website redesign timeline during scoping.
Website redesign cost varies based on the scope — number of page templates, complexity of the design system, platform, integrations and whether SEO migration work is included. A straightforward B2B or SaaS website redesign will be different from a full ecommerce or enterprise redesign. We provide fixed-price proposals after a structured scoping session.
A website redesign can affect SEO if it is not handled carefully — URL changes, missing redirects, altered metadata and dropped content are the most common causes of ranking loss after a redesign. Our website redesign services include a full SEO plan: URL mapping, redirect implementation, metadata transfer and post-launch ranking monitoring to protect and recover your visibility.
A full website redesign service typically includes UX audit, conversion analysis, new UX and visual design, development, content migration, SEO redirect mapping, QA, launch and post-launch support. The exact scope depends on the project — some redesigns include a platform change while others are a design and development refresh on the existing CMS.
Common reasons to redesign a website include poor conversion rates, outdated design, slow page speed, a rebrand, a shift in target audience, a new product offering or a platform that is difficult to manage or scale. If your site is consistently underperforming against your business goals, a structured website redesign process is usually more effective than incremental fixes.
